A small family-owned business will increase its turnover by 35.2% this year and, on new M-Cs, consistently machines to tolerances which would frighten the majority of engineers.
It has earned an enviable list of accreditations, has a substantial, blue-chip customer base which includes customers in the Unites States of America, Canada, Hong Kong, Sweden and Germany as well as the UK, has a training programme which even the ISO 9000 assessor said was the best he had ever come across, and it consistently machines to tolerances which would frighten the majority of engineers - on one job alone it achieves a surface finish of 0.22 micron CLA.
The Somerset and Dorset Manufacturing Network asked APL, as a forward thinking company in Somerset, to host a workshop on the Vision 20-20 programme, a DTI initiative operated by Plymouth University in APL's area.
Run by Paul Adams and sister Julie, the company has set out to become a Model of Excellence.

It is working with management gurus at Exeter University to develop a Business Improvement Programme which includes a workable mission statement divided into measurable projects, each lead and monitored by a project leader within the business.
The company's success so far can be attributed to its careful identification of its markets and a determination to provide what those markets need alongside a carefully controlled diversification programme.
Paul Adams said "We seek difficult work, which the majority of our competitors shy away from.
We look for, and obtain, high featured jobs with high added value, often critical parts or safety related parts in the defence, aerospace, medical, and fibre optics industries.
We are prepared to work to exceptionally tight tolerances, in difficult materials, on complex machining tasks.
"We also provide a sophisticated product design service, working with the customer to improve the production of a component and/or to improve its performance.
For instance, we recently took on a part which had been soft turned, heat treated and then ground to meet the tight tolerances required.
We are able to soft turn, heat treat, then hard turn the component and have improved the tolerance so as to achieve less than 1 micron roundness and a surface finish of 0.07 micron CLA.".
One example of the company's imaginative and innovative management approach is the purchase of two horizontal machining centres from the Heller MC range, manufactured in Redditch.
The first machine was bought early in 2001, the second some seven months later.
The first Heller was purchased strictly in order to cope efficiently with an ever-increasing workload.
Paul Adams assessed the machines available and selected the Heller because "We were very impressed with the company's systems and the design and quality of the machine.
A team of people, including setters, supervisors, and production engineers, made the assessment over several weeks and we unanimously agreed that Heller was the best.
We had a great deal of advice and assistance from Heller throughout our selection process, and once the decision was made.
Back up and support was - and remains - excellent.
"We believe we stand apart from our competitors because we provide exceptional quality.
We machine materials and features which most other companies cannot, to tolerances which few companies can achieve, so we choose to invest only in good quality machines.
We also expect at least five years of heavy use from a machine tool - the machines run 106 hours every week.
We identified Heller as offering the best machine to meet those criteria, and also the right back up".
Paul reconsidered the machines the company was using because they were not holding tolerance, despite sophisticated compensation software.
Heller was the only manufacturer which was prepared to take the problem seriously, and to substantiate its claims with technical data and test results.
Paul commented "We were bowled over with the attention which we received, and especially the written guarantee of tolerance.
That has since been substantiated.
We have now been operating the machine for a year and, where we used to make offset changes continually during a shift, now we only have to make offset changes with a tool change.
A Cpk of 2.25 is consistently being achieved".
Clearly holding tolerance much better even than Paul had hoped, the Heller has also proved to be significantly faster.
Initially, the programme was converted from the existing machine to the Heller, using the same cutting data.
Cycle time was immediately reduced by 11%.
Once the operators had the confidence to exploit the power and rigidity of the Heller, cycle time was reduced by a further 16%, an overall reduction in cycle time of 25%.
"We have been able to double the feed rate and reduce the number of passes we make" Paul commented.
"Primarily, we use the Heller for aluminium alloys, but the reduced cycle time has released enough capacity to move a steel component onto it.
The Heller has proved to have all the torque needed for taking quite heavy cuts, so we have found a great deal of versatility in the machine as well as accuracy - our main concern - and speed.
"We purchased a second machine because the first has proved to be the most profitable machine in the shop.
The second, an MC 16.1, is a faster machine (60m/min rather than 40m/min) and that has reduced cycle time by another 7%". Request a free brochure from Heller Machine Tools ...
